The law or principle of cross-cutting relationships states that any geologic feature or rock body that cuts across or deforms another is the younger of the two, i.e., it is younger than the geologic structure, feature, or rock body it cuts through or deforms. Weblithification, complex process whereby freshly deposited loose grains of sediment are converted into rock. Lithification may occur at the time a sediment is deposited or later. Cementation is one of the main processes involved, particularly for sandstones and conglomerates. In addition, reactions take place within a sediment between various …

Senior Research Scientist, National Institute for Occupational Safety and Heath . 2. Senior Manager (R&D), Peabody Energy. WebFigure 3.6.11. The formation of evaporite sedimentary rocks. As a closed off body of water, such as a lake, evaporates over time, minerals will precipitate in the following order: calcite, gypsum, halite.
